A popup asking me to connect to the internet appears again and again. A program is requesting the addresses www.smutfantazy.com or 66.250.131.242. The IE is not even running, and I cannot identify the program trying to connect.

Tried several things:
Searching for virus' or spy's by F-Secure, Spyhunter, HijackThis.

Some ideas how to cure this?

You probalby have a dialer that is trying to connect all the time.
check our internet connections to see if you have a dialup listed that you do not recognize.

Also check your startup in msconfig to see what programs are running in your startup.

Post the Hijackthis log too.

When the request pops up look at your "settings" and make sure the button that is next to "never dial the connection" is checked. this might correct the problem. I have had the same thing happen and when I changed that it never came back.
